App Guide
A clear picture of every screen and feature in SchoolNet — what you see and what you can do
Getting Started
When you open the app, you’ll see a short loading screen, then either sign in or create an account. New users choose their role (Student, Teacher, Parent, or Admin) before entering the main app.
Sign in: Use email and password, or sign in with Google.
Create account: Enter your details, verify your email if prompted, then select your role.
Bottom Navigation
After signing in, the main screen has a bottom bar with four tabs. What you see depends on your role:
- Home — Your dashboard (different for students, teachers, parents, and admins)
- Notes / Assignments — Class notes or assignments (labelled based on the tab you’re on)
- Timetable / Activity / Results — Your schedule, your children’s activity, or results
- Profile — Your account, settings, and school info
What Students See
Home Screen
A welcome message, your class, and quick stats (e.g. study time, assignments done). Cards take you to:
- Timetable — Your weekly schedule by day (subject, time, room)
- Class Notes — Documents and videos shared by teachers, with filters by subject
- Assignments — Homework and tasks with due dates; tap to open attachments
- Results — Report cards when published by your school
Assignments Screen
A feed of assignments and notices. Search bar at the top. Each assignment shows title, class, subject, due date, and teacher. Tap to view details and open attachments (PDFs, images).
Class Notes Screen
Tabs for Documents and Videos. Notes are shown as cards with subject, title, and teacher. Tap to view or play.
Timetable Screen
Days of the week as tabs. For each day, a list of lessons with time, subject, and room.
Results Screen
If your school has published results, you’ll see your report card. Tap to open a full report with grades, totals, and teacher comments. Supports Uganda grading (PLE, O-Level, A-Level) and the new S1–S4 curriculum format.
What Teachers See
Home Screen
A greeting and cards for:
- Post Assignment — Create homework with title, class, subject, description, attachment, and due date
- My Assignments — List of all assignments you’ve posted; tap to edit or delete
- Create Notice — Post school announcements
- Record Discipline — Log discipline incidents for students
- Class Notes — Upload documents and videos for your classes
- Panel — Manage class lists and mark lists (for class teachers)
- Class Activity — See which students have opened notes (for class teachers)
- Approve Join Requests — Approve teachers and students joining your class (for class teachers)
Post Assignment Screen
Form with dropdowns for class and subject, fields for title and description, file attachment, and optional due date. At the bottom, a list of your recent assignments.
My Assignments Screen
A full list of your posted assignments. Each card shows title, class, subject, posted date, description, due date, and attachment. Use the menu (⋮) to edit or delete.
Panel Screen
Class lists (e.g. Primary 5 East) with student names and IDs. Create new class lists by uploading a file or adding names. For each class, you can create mark lists, enter marks, and publish results. Marks can be imported from a spreadsheet (CSV) or entered by hand. For S1–S4, you enter formative scores (U1–U4) and summative scores (Midterm, End of Term) per subject.
Assignments & Notices Feed
Same as students, but teachers see an add button to post new items. Teachers can edit or delete their own assignments from the feed.
What Parents See
Home Screen
Your linked children shown as cards. Tap a child to see their activity. If you haven’t linked any children, you’ll see a prompt to add their Student ID and access code.
Activity Screen
One view per child. Tabs for:
- Assignments — Their assignments, grouped by child
- Notes — Class notes shared with their class
- Results — Published report cards
You can see how often they’ve opened each item. Tap an assignment or note to view it. Tap a result to open the full report card.
Profile
Manage linked children. Add a child by entering their Student ID and access code. You can also view app usage (e.g. study time) for linked children on supported devices.
What School Admins See
Home Screen
Cards for:
- Manage Classes — Add or edit classes and streams
- Manage Teachers — Add teachers and assign class teachers
- Join Requests — Approve or reject teachers and students joining your school
- Edit School — Update school name, address, logo
- Timetable — Set the school timetable
You also have access to assignments, notices, and notes like teachers.
Report Cards
The app supports different report styles depending on the class level:
- Primary (PLE) — Grades like D1, D2, C4, etc., with aggregate
- O-Level / S1–S4 — New curriculum: formative (units 1–4), summative (midterm and end of term), and term average with letter grades (A*, A, B, C, D, E)
- A-Level (UACE) — Letter grades with points
Report cards show school name, student details, subject results, grading scale, totals, and comments from the class teacher and head teacher.
Profile & Settings
From Profile you can:
- View and edit your name and photo
- See your role and school
- Request a new feature
- Delete your account
Teachers can see a QR code to help students join the school. Parents manage linked children from here.
Notifications
You get alerts when:
- New assignments or notices are posted
- New class notes are shared
- Results are published
- Teachers and admins: when someone requests to join the school
Tapping a notification opens the app to the relevant screen (e.g. the new assignment or result).
Where It Runs
SchoolNet works on phones, tablets, and desktops. Use it in a browser on a computer, or install the app on Android or iOS. Your data stays in sync across all devices.
